Author, broadcaster, speaker and lifestyle guru, Lynne Franks has a communication reach that stretches across the world. As a high-profile business woman and founder of the SEED empowerment programmes for women, she is either featured in or writes for many of the UK’s top publications, as well as regularly appearing in international media, television and radio, speaking on the subjects of social change, consumer patterns, corporate responsibility and women in business.


Lynne started her own public relations company, Lynne Franks PR, from her kitchen table at the age of twenty-one, which grew to become one of the best known agencies in the world, advising and guiding multi-national businesses and non-profit organisation around the globe.


In 1992, she gave up her agency and became an international spokesperson and facilitator on the changes in today’s and tomorrow’s world - both for the individual as well as society at large.


In 1994, she chaired the UK’s first women’s radio station, presenting her own radio show “Frankly Speaking”. She has authored four books and has designed workshops and training programmes that bring her new ideas for women to life. SEED has become the provider of one of the most internationally recognised women’s enterprise and leadership training programmes, as well as a global women’s network.
